SICILY. Syracuse. Dionysios I, 406-367 B.C. AR Decadrachm (41.12 gms), ca. 405-370 B.C.
Gallatin-R.XXI/J.II. Unsigned work by Euainetos. Fast quadriga driven left by female charioteer leaning forward with a kentron in right hand and reins in left hand, Nike flying right to crown her; Reverse: Head of Arethusa facing left wearing barley wreath, four dolphins around. Good strike with fine style dies, though some die rust is evident. Previously smoothed, though only lightly. Overall a pleasing example of this exceptionally popular and important series. NGC Ch VF, Strike: 4/5 Surface: 2/5. Fine Style. Light Smoothing.
